Transaction 259734fe1d932c33ac7196c988a38ae83904074f31cf31e18b053ff4895a88fd

1 Input
2 Outputs
  • 259734fe1d932c33ac7196c988a38ae83904074f31cf31e18b053ff4895a88fd:0
  • value  300000000
    address  3BS4SV5SRzYbvybDahp9ZDKKYUJuQAFwaW
  • 259734fe1d932c33ac7196c988a38ae83904074f31cf31e18b053ff4895a88fd:1
  • value  699910000
    address  bc1qwqdg6squsna38e46795at95yu9atm8azzmyvckulcc7kytlcckxswvvzej